ABOUT PROJECT
The Technical Project Manager is responsible for the day-to-day management of requirement intake, coordination and management of the team's architecture and design activities and alignment and handover to the SW development teams; including tracking of dependencies on other technical teams and stakeholders required by the vendors and the SW architects to implement requirements according to the requirement.
The Technical Project Manager is expected to acquire an overall understanding of the project as well as the architecture and high-level design to independently identify activities required and dependencies to track to secure team deliverables.
Responsibilities
Do initial scanning of requirements to confirm the impact on the team
Understand and clarify the business and product goals and objectives behind the requirement
Review and clarify business requirements and acceptance criteria's
Ensure requirements are clear and complete before handover to development teams
Manage requirements, technical work packages, and activities in Jira
Track dependencies on other technology teams and stakeholders
Perform vendor management: day-to-day management of vendor activities, review/QA of vendor deliverables
Plan, track and evaluate deliverables from vendors, assuring the quality of deliverables
Identify the need for the introduction of new processes and updates to existing processes
